Firmware block:

CYCLIC CORRECTION

(64)
This block
• selects the cyclic correction mode
• defines the source for the latching
command for position probe 1/2
• defines the reference position for
probe 1/2
• defines the maximum absolute
value for cyclic correction.
When the probe latching conditions
are fulfilled, the encoder module
saves the encoder position (to signal
4.03 PROBE1 POS MEAS or 4.04
PROBE2 POS MEAS).
62.14 CYCLIC CORR MODE
Selects the cyclic correction mode.
(0) DISABLED
(1) COR ACT POS
(2) COR MAS REF
(3) 1 PROBE DIST
